Nutrition for Growth Summit: France resumes the torch of the fight against malnutrition
After Japan in 2021, France is organizing the 3rd edition of the Nutrition for Growth Summit in Paris, Thursday 27 and Friday 28 March. Destined to give new impetus to the fight against malnutrition that affects more than 700 million people around the world, the meeting has already mobilized $27 billion in pledges to try to stop this scourge.
Nutrition for Growth Summit: leaders call for solidarity amid a funding crisis
A major summit to discuss global efforts to tackle malnutrition kicked off in Paris. The meeting comes as international humanitarian organisations face a funding crisis sparked by the Trump Administration halting a majority of the US's foreign aid programmes.
